Description

BSE suspends trading in two series of non-convertible debentures of ICL FINCORP LIMITED effective December 17, 2025, due to upcoming redemption and interest payment.

Summary

BSE has issued Notice No. 20251212-78 directing trading members to suspend dealings in two series of non-convertible debentures (NCDs) issued by ICL FINCORP LIMITED effective December 17, 2025. The suspension is mandated due to the company fixing the record date for redemption of debentures and payment of interest.

Key Points

  • Two NCD series affected: ICLFL-11%-02-01-26-NCD (ISIN: INE01CY078Q3, Code: 939917) and ICLFL-02-1-26-NCD (ISIN: INE01CY078N0, Code: 939925)
  • Record date fixed: December 17, 2025
  • No dealings permitted from: December 17, 2025
  • Purpose: Redemption of debentures and payment of interest
  • Circular reference: DR-779/2025-2026
  • Trading members are strictly advised not to deal in the mentioned debentures

Impact Assessment

Market Impact: Limited to holders of the two specific NCD series. The suspension prevents trading for a defined period to facilitate orderly redemption and interest payment processing.

Investor Impact: Debenture holders will receive their redemption proceeds and interest payments as per the terms. Liquidity is temporarily restricted but this is standard procedure for corporate actions.

Operational Impact: Trading members must update their systems to block trading in these ISINs from December 17, 2025. Back-office teams need to process redemption and interest payments for clients holding these securities as of the record date.
